Output a4572938766e7ba0ac1e4e3326f01b30389aa1620dbc02612759da1569ef06a4:8

value
137628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ea0b4b4dcbf9780bd936a5eae8028117c931be4 OP_EQUAL
address
3Bmxmgj2wEDcfaFFC8w3UjPgAcZheo3DzR
transaction
a4572938766e7ba0ac1e4e3326f01b30389aa1620dbc02612759da1569ef06a4
confirmations
319911
spent
true